7. Press the cleaning button. The printer moves the print
head and begins charging the ink delivery system.
Note:
Even if you do not press the
cleaning button, the printer
moves the print head and begins the ink charging process about
60 seconds after you install both ink cartridges.
The ink charging process may take about five minutes to
complete, during which time the printer produces a variety
of mechanical sounds. These sounds are normal. When the
ink delivery system has been charged, the print head
returns to its home (far right) position.
8. Close the printer cover.

Caution:
During the ink charging process, the
power light flashes.
Never turn off the printer while the
power light is flashing.
The life of a cartridge depends on the amount of text and
black-and-white graphics you print (for a black cartridge) and
the amount and the number of colors you use in your
documents (for a color cartridge).
